Rocket Mortgage Classic details
- Date: July 28-31, 2022
- Location: Detroit, Michigan
- Course: Detroit Golf Club
- Par: 72 / 7,340 yards
- Purse: 8.4M
- Defending Champ: Cameron Davis
Course comparison – Detroit Golf Club
- The par 72 measures 7,340 yards for this week, which is 75 yards longer than the average Tour stop over the past 12 months.
- Over the last year, PGA Tour stops have seen an average score of -4, while Detroit Golf Club has a recent scoring average of -11.
- The average course Scott has played over the past year has been 31 yards shorter than the 7,340 yards Detroit Golf Club will measure for this event.
- The tournaments he’s played over the past year have seen an average score of -4. That’s higher than this course’s recent scoring average of -11.

Adam Scott 2022 results
Date | Event | Finish | Score | SG – Tee to Green | SG – Putting | Earnings |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
July 13-16 | The Open Championship | 15 | 72-65-70-71 (-10) | 2.004 | 0.768 | $165,583 |
June 16-20 | U.S. Open | 14 | 69-73-72-68 (+2) | 10.24 | 4.84 | $241,302 |
June 2- 6 | the Memorial Tournament pres. by Workday | 67 | 70-76-73-80 (+11) | -2.512 | 13.336 | $25,200 |
May 19-22 | PGA Championship | MC | 77-70 | -7.024 | -1.310 | $0 |
May 12-15 | AT&T Byron Nelson | 32 | 67-69-71-65 (-16) | 4.392 | 8.428 | $50,808 |
April 7-10 | Masters Tournament | 48 | 74-74-80-74 (+14) | -2.152 | 1.484 | $0 |
March 10-13 | THE PLAYERS Championship | MC | 78-70 | -1.392 | -0.249 | $0 |
March 3- 6 | Arnold Palmer Invitational pres. by Mastercard | 26 | 68-76-74-74 (+4) | -2.292 | 6.472 | $87,600 |
February 17-20 | The Genesis Invitational | 4 | 68-65-71-66 (-14) | 4.362 | 7.201 | $540,000 |
February 10-13 | Waste Management Phoenix Open | 38 | 68-70-69-72 (-5) | 0.191 | 1.717 | $35,670 |
